Total Student Population Comparison

The total student population of selected colleges is 7,741 with 4,980 female students and 2,761 male students. This enrollment statistics is based on the latest data from IPEDS, U.S. Department of Education for academic year 2022-2023. The following table compares the student population for both undergraduate and graduate schools between selected colleges.
Among the selected colleges, Moravian University has the most enrolled students of 2,533, while Pennsylvania Academy of the Fine Arts has the least number of students of 172 for both in graduate and undergraduate programs.

Undergraduate Student Population

The total undergraduate population of selected colleges is 5,646 with 3,549 female students and 2,097 male students. The following table compares 2022-2023 undergraduate enrollment between selected colleges.
Among the selected colleges, Moravian University has the most enrolled undergraduate students of 1,904, while Pennsylvania Academy of the Fine Arts has the least number of undergraduate students of 114.

Graduate Student Population

The total graduate population of selected colleges is 2,095 with 1,431 female students and 664 male students. The following table compares 2022-2023 graduate enrollment between selected colleges.
Among the selected colleges, Chatham University has the most enrolled graduate students of 888, while Pennsylvania Academy of the Fine Arts has the least number of graduate students of 58.

Distance Learning (Online Class) Enrollment

The following table compares 2022-2023 distance learning enrollment for both undergraduate and graduate programs between selected colleges. In undergraduate programs, out of total 5,646 students, 910 students (16.12%) have taken courses only through distance learning and 1,928 students (34.15%) have learned from at least one online course. For graduate schools, out of total 2,095 students, 462 students (22.05%) have taken courses only through distance learning and 280 students (13.37%) have learned from at least one online course.
